Key elements of your role as Restaurant Administrator
- Maintain office services including office operations and procedures, assigning and monitoring all administration functions
- Have Fourth Hospitality programme knowledge and be able to check right to work, close employee rotas and maintain accurate employee files
- Complete daily banking procedures as well as supporting and checking cash out
- Ensuring all end of day reports are consistent and to company standards
- Support the ordering of equipment, stationary, uniforms and crockery
- Organise weekly stock takes and prepare invoices
- Monitor the business occupancy tracker and help standardise operational procedures
About you
- You have 2 year + experience in this position (or similar)
- You have the experience and skills to oversee and support the entire front and back of house admin operation
- You have strong IT skills
- You have excellent English language skills
